Overview
Decisions during drinking (D3) is randomized clinical feasibility trial assessing whether health-related materials created for young adults who want to have more positive experiences if they decide to drink alcohol are acceptable and usable. Enrolled participants will be randomized to receive the health-related messages in 5-7 online modules over the 20-30 days or to only receive assessments. Those randomized to receive the intervention will also receive text-messages with health message content during the 20-30 days. After completing the intervention, participants will report on the usability and acceptability of the material, which is the main outcome. For secondary outcomes, participants in both the intervention and control will report on their drinking and drinking-related consequences in the post-intervention questionnaire (or 30 days after initial questionnaire for control participants) and 1 month later.
Eligibility
Inclusion Criteria:
- Aged 18-24
- At least 1 occurrence of heavy drinking in the past month
- At least 2 alcohol related consequences in the past month
- Live in Washington State
- Agree to be randomized to receive intervention to assessment only control
- Ability to receive SMS text-messages
- Complete Identification verification
Exclusion Criteria:
- Not meeting inclusion criteria
- Not being able to verify identification
